Eddie Izzard is a renowned British comedian known for his unique blend of humor, wit, and intellect. He often incorporates elements of religion and philosophy into his stand-up routines, using them as a source of inspiration and material for his jokes. Izzard's approach to these topics is both thought-provoking and entertaining, as he navigates the complexities of belief systems and existential questions with his trademark style of observational comedy.

When it comes to religion and philosophy, Izzard recognizes the inherent differences between the two disciplines. Religion is typically associated with organized belief systems, rituals, and practices that are based on faith and tradition. Philosophy, on the other hand, is a more abstract and analytical pursuit that seeks to understand the nature of reality, knowledge, and existence through reason and critical thinking. While religion and philosophy may have different approaches and goals, Izzard sees them as complementary aspects of the human experience that can offer valuable insights into the nature of life and the universe.

In his comedy, Izzard often explores the absurdities and contradictions of religious beliefs, poking fun at the dogmas and doctrines that can sometimes seem illogical or outdated. At the same time, he also delves into the deeper philosophical questions that underlie our understanding of the world, such as the nature of morality, free will, and the meaning of life. By blending humor with intellectual inquiry, Izzard challenges his audience to think critically about these complex and often controversial topics, while also encouraging them to find humor and joy in the absurdities of human existence.

Izzard's unique perspective on religion and philosophy reflects his own eclectic background and interests. As a self-described "executive transvestite" and advocate for LGBTQ rights, he has often spoken out against the conservative attitudes and prejudices that can be perpetuated by religious institutions. At the same time, he has also expressed a deep appreciation for the beauty and mystery of the universe, drawing inspiration from the philosophical traditions of thinkers such as Socrates, Descartes, and Nietzsche.
